Dubbo支持多种注册中心,用于服务的注册、发现和管理。以下是Dubbo常见的注册中心:
-
Zookeeper:
- Zookeeper是Dubbo最常用的注册中心之一。Zookeeper提供了分布式的协调服务,可以用于服务的注册、发现和配置管理。
<dubbo:registry address="zookeeper://127.0.0.1:2181" /> -
Redis:
- Dubbo也支持使用Redis作为注册中心。Redis是一个高性能的分布式缓存和键值存储系统。
<dubbo:registry address="redis://127.0.0.1:6379" /> -
Multicast:
- Multicast是一种基于UDP的注册中心,支持广播模式。通常用于测试和开发环境。
<dubbo:registry address="multicast://224.1.1.1:9090" /> -
Simple:
- Simple注册中心主要用于调试和开发阶段,不推荐在生产环境中使用。
<dubbo:registry address="simple://127.0.0.1:9090" /> -
Consul:
- Consul是一种支持多数据中心的分布式服务发现和配置共享的注册中心。
<dubbo:registry address="consul://127.0.0.1:8500" /> -
Etcd:
- Etcd是一个分布式的键值存储系统,也可以用作Dubbo的注册中心。
<dubbo:registry address="etcd://127.0.0.1:2379" />
以上是Dubbo常见的注册中心,具体选择哪个注册中心取决于项目的实际需求和架构设计。在生产环境中,通常选择Zookeeper等稳定而成熟的注册中心。Dubbo的灵活性使得可以相对容易地切换和配置不同的注册中心。
Was this helpful?
0 / 0